What Is Administrative Law?

Administrative law governs the actions and decisions of government agencies. It includes rules, regulations, and procedures these agencies must follow. This area of law ensures that federal, state, county, and local government actions are legal and fair. Administrative law covers various activities from federal, Florida, and Seffner agencies, from issuing licenses and permits to enforcing regulations on businesses and handling disputes between the government and people or private companies.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need an Administrative Lawyer?

You might need an administrative lawyer if you’re dealing with a government agency over issues like:

  • Permits or licenses
  • Regulatory compliance
  • Disciplinary actions, fines, or enforcement actions
  • Appealing a denied benefit or service
  • Challenging an agency’s decision
  • Navigating complex regulatory requirements for your business

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ire an Administrative Lawyer?

If you don’t hire an administrative lawyer, you might struggle to navigate complex government regulations and procedures independently. Without legal guidance, you could miss important deadlines, fail to present a strong case, or misunderstand your rights and obligations. This could result in denied applications, fines, or other penalties. You might also have difficulty challenging unfair government actions or decisions.
